Ryan Thomas Monahan hails from Yorkville, Illinois. Utilizing a combination of physical and imaginative exploration Ryan creates miniaturized three dimensional portraits of urban landscapes. His desire to capture the beauty and grime of the world we live in is filled with moments of agony and glory. The exhibit title: “Between Heaven N’ Hell” refers to Ryan’s love/hate relationship with his creative process and the adventures it takes him on.
Look around, could you reproduce your environment using materials of no relation to their original purpose and fit it all inside a space the size of a shoe box? Construction is a difficult process; the required knowledge brings many different professions together. However, in this instance, Ryan is the ultimate construction worker – He does it all from the ground up at 1/24 the scale.
The majority of Ryan’s work portrays a fictional location. Creating a unique environment allows him to pull inspiration from visual and personal influences. It also allows him to consider using anything and everything for materials – Call him a “Junk Drawer Pirate”.

Chris Dean is a Detroit based artist specializing in the medium of lenticular printmaking. Dean's brightly colored work uses lenticular's unique capacity for illusion to create interactive compositions of depth and motion. The visually dense work prioritizes direct experience and focuses on the intersection of the recognizable and the unfamiliar.
Dean began exploring lenticular and related processes as a student at San Jose State in the mid 90's during the rise in interest in virtual reality technologies. Working first with stereoscopic processes and later lenticular, Dean has spent the years exploring approaches to these interactive mediums. Dean has exhibited widely in the United States and beyond and is the owner of the lenticular production company Midwest Lenticular.

Gillick’s work exposes the dysfunctional aspects of a modernist legacy in terms of abstraction and architecture when framed within a globalized, neo-liberal consensus. His work extends into structural rethinking of the exhibition as a form. He deploys multiple forms to expose the new ideological control systems that emerged at the beginning of the 1990s.
"By making the abstract concrete, art no longer retains any abstract quality, it merely announces a constant striving for a state of abstraction and in turn produces more abstraction to pursue." -Liam Gillick
